Today we’d like to introduce you to Jordan Cobb.
Jordan, we appreciate you taking the time to share your story with us today. Where does your story begin?
I started IVitamin in 2016 during a season of my life where everything looked good from the outside — and felt overwhelming on the inside.
At the time, I was in medical device sales. I had two babies under two years old. My days started before sunrise, often in the operating room before my kids were awake, and ended with me racing home just in time to kiss them goodnight. I was a mom, a wife, a high performer at work — and I was exhausted.
I lived on caffeine, adrenaline, and willpower. I was pushing through instead of listening to my body. I remember thinking, I’ve built this beautiful life… why does it feel so hard to keep up with it?
That’s when my best friend of over 25 years and also a pharmacist came to me with an idea. What if we created a place in Austin where people could actually support their bodies instead of running them into the ground? A place focused on real health, not trends- a proactive stance on wellness. On feeling good consistently, not just surviving the week.
That idea became IVitamin and it was Austin’s first brick and mortar IV Hydration Lounge.
When we opened our doors, most people had no idea what IV therapy was. There was no roadmap. No proven business model. We were building something new, and we were doing it while raising young children and figuring out life in real time.
From day one, safety mattered more than anything. Having a pharmacist as a co-founder allowed us to lead with integrity and clinical excellence in a space that didn’t always prioritize either. And being mothers building a business together meant we gave each other grace — because life doesn’t pause just because you’re an entrepreneur.
The journey hasn’t been easy. It’s been challenging, messy, and at times really hard. But it’s also been incredibly fulfilling.
Over the years, IVitamin grew into something much bigger than we imagined. We built a loyal, membership-based community of people who believe, like we do, that feeling good shouldn’t be optional. That as we age, we don’t have to accept exhaustion, brain fog, or slow recovery as “normal.”
We’ve expanded into advanced longevity services like NAD, Niagen, Peptides, and Exosomes and have clinical testing that gives patients real data. And now after getting started 10 years ago we have four locations serving the greater Austin community and have safely and successfully delivered over 100,000 IVs. Alright, so let’s dig a little deeper into the story – has it been an easy path overall and if not, what were the challenges you’ve had to overcome?
Not at all. And I don’t think most meaningful businesses are!
We built IVitamin from the ground up with no outside funding. We bootstrapped it ourselves, which meant wearing every hat, making hard decisions, and learning as we went — often the hard way. There was no proven model when we started. IV therapy wasn’t mainstream, and we had to spend years simply educating people on what it was and why it mattered.
Being female entrepreneurs added another layer. We had to work harder to be taken seriously in a medical-adjacent space, especially early on. We led with integrity, safety, and consistency, even when it would have been easier to chase trends or shortcuts. Having a pharmacist as a co-founder helped establish credibility, but we still had to earn trust every single day.
Then COVID hit. Like many businesses, it was one of the most stressful periods we’ve ever faced. There was uncertainty, fear, and constant change. We had to protect our team, our clients, and the business all at the same time, while continuing to make payroll and navigate regulations that shifted weekly. There were moments when it felt like everything we had built was at risk.
On a personal level, balancing motherhood, marriage, and entrepreneurship has been one of the biggest challenges. Building a business while raising young children requires sacrifice, flexibility, and a lot of grace — both for yourself and your partner.
But those challenges shaped IVitamin into what it is today. They forced us to build thoughtfully, stay grounded in our values, and focus on long-term sustainability over quick wins. Every obstacle reinforced why we started in the first place — to build something meaningful, ethical, and lasting.
